A very touching memoir, this book explores the up and downs (and even more ups) of living with and surviving a mental illness. Even if you've not been affected by someone living with this illness, you'll still be able to relate to Karen's situations and the emotional roller coaster of reactions to the harassment she endured. At times you will even smile along with this real-life character. ...more

Australian, Karen Tyrrell has bi-polar, an illness that affects many millions of people. Her memoir, Me and Her: A Memoir of Madness, is about her life with bipolar. The book is her quest to understand and control her bipolar, and her quest to find out why she developed the illness.
